Title
Luther Snyder House
Subject
Residential Architecture
Description
This building was built in 1920 in the Colonial-Revival style for Luther Snyder. The red-brick, location, and size all added to the prestigious nature of the Myers Park neighborhood. Now a part of Queens University, the Luther Snyder House is part of a condominium-dorm project.
